The Athletic: Chelsea actively looking to sign a new holding midfielder

The transfer window slams shut in just under two weeks, and it looks like Chelsea will make one last push to sign one more high calibre player.

Chelsea want to sign a new holding midfielder, according to The Athletic.

Frank Lampard does not count N’Golo Kante as a holding midfielder, and there are doubts over the ability of Jorginho to play that role, as well as doubts over his Chelsea future.

It appears that Lampard wants a more robust and traditional defensive midfielder, and the name Declan Rice pops up yet again.

Chelsea are expected to make a move to sign the West Ham midfielder imminently, despite his club being determined not to sell by valuing him at £80 million.

But Rice putting in a request to move to his club could see it move along, and Chelsea may also offer Ross Barkley as part of the deal in an attempt to bring the price down, as per the same report from The Athletic.
